Job Description

The Chief Growth Officer is a strategic marketing leader, with proven experience in fundraising and communications, a strong background in supporting mission-driven organizations, and a track record of leading successful fundraising and marketing campaigns.

Position Overview

One of Hawai‘i’s most respected nonprofit healthcare organizations seeks a creative and strategic Chief Growth Officer to lead efforts in marketing, fundraising, and brand development. Rooted in a mission of compassion and care, the organization provides support to individuals and families facing serious illness and end-of-life journeys. The CGO will play a critical role in advancing the organization’s mission by growing community awareness, deepening donor engagement, and strengthening internal and external communications.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ement strategic marketing and communications plans
  • Build brand awareness through content creation, media outreach, and digital campaigns
  • Lead fundraising strategy across individual giving, foundations, government sources, and events
  • Cultivate major donors and oversee stewardship activities
  • Guide internal communications and stakeholder engagement
  • Manage and mentor a team of four, including business development and philanthropy staff
  • Collaborate with executive leadership and board on growth and sustainability goals
  • Oversee budget management and campaign performance analytics

Skills

  • Strategic marketing and communications
  • Fundraising and donor development
  • Team leadership and performance management
  • Community and stakeholder engagement
  • Digital marketing (social media, SEO, content strategy)
  • Data-driven planning and C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ce, Raiser’s Edge)
  • Public relations and media strategy
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in marketing, communications, or related field (advanced degree preferred)
  • 5–7 years of experience in marketing and fundraising leadership, ideally in nonprofit and/or healthcare
  • Proven track record of growing brand visibility and increasing revenue through campaigns
  • Experience managing staff and working cross-functionally with executive leadership
  • Proficiency in CRM systems and marketing analytics tools
  • Alignment with mission-driven work
